"blueprint-label-printer-windows-driver-v2.7.2.1.exe" is an essential piece of utility software designed to bridge the communication gap between Blueprint thermal label printers and computers running the Windows operating system. As a driver, its primary function is to translate digital data from a PC into a physical format that the printer can interpret, ensuring that labels, barcodes, and receipts are produced with high precision and speed.
